AI Summary

HF3495 Summary

  • Establishes uniform mental health service standards including functional and level of care assessments using standardized instruments (ESCII, CASII, LOCUS) for clients of all ages

  • Creates engagement services pilot grant program to provide culturally responsive early interventions preventing civil commitment, with evaluation required using experimental design

  • Modifies substance use disorder treatment qualifications to allow "qualified professionals" (including mental health professionals, nurses with training, and clinical trainees) to conduct assessments and treatment planning, not just licensed alcohol and drug counselors

  • Establishes Mental Health and Substance Use Disorder Education Center in Department of Health to address workforce shortages through career exposure, loan forgiveness expansion, and training for other healthcare professionals

  • Appropriates $16.972 million in fiscal year 2025 for engagement services pilots, respite care services, children's residential treatment programs, in-home mental health infrastructure, and other behavioral health initiatives; adjusts general assistance standards effective October 1, 2024

Legislative Description

Mental and behavioral health care provisions modified including service standards, adult and child mental health services grants, substance use disorder services, supportive housing, and provider certification and reimbursement; reports required; and money appropriated.
